Association of serum biomarkers with early neurologic improvement after intravenous thrombolysis in ischemic stroke
BACKGROUND: Early neurologic improvement (ENI) after intravenous thrombolysis is associated with favorable outcome, but associated serum biomarkers were not fully determined.
